RFR: 8262882: Lanai: NetBeans crashes often when switching between dual and single screen

Ajit Ghaisas aghaisas at openjdk.java.net
Tue Mar 9 09:01:26 UTC 2021


Corrected MTLContext.dealloc() method to set released members to nil.
Setting texturePool member to nil causes double release as texturePool content gets released in MTLCommandBufferWrapper.onComplete() method as well.

-------------

Commit messages:
 - fix MTLContext dispose

Changes: https://git.openjdk.java.net/lanai/pull/211/files
 Webrev: https://webrevs.openjdk.java.net/?repo=lanai&pr=211&range=00
  Issue: https://bugs.openjdk.java.net/browse/JDK-8262882
  Stats: 59 lines in 3 files changed: 46 ins; 4 del; 9 mod
  Patch: https://git.openjdk.java.net/lanai/pull/211.diff
  Fetch: git fetch https://git.openjdk.java.net/lanai pull/211/head:pull/211

PR: https://git.openjdk.java.net/lanai/pull/211


More information about the lanai-dev mailing list